Job Summary
The Cybersecurity Compliance Program Manager leads and oversees the organization’s comprehensive cybersecurity compliance initiatives, ensuring alignment with key standards such as CMMC, ISO 27001, SOX, PCI DSS, and Cyber Essentials. This role is responsible for developing and maintaining compliance policies, coordinating and managing internal and external audits, conducting risk assessments, and driving remediation efforts. The manager collaborates with cross-functional stakeholders to ensure regulatory adherence, proactively identifies areas for process improvement, and provides expert guidance to mitigate organizational risk while supporting a culture of security and compliance.
